Box 479 Yelm, Washington 98597 (360) 458-3244 Re: Site Plan Approval for Case # SPR-01-8290-YL, Lasco Bathware Loading Docks Dear Mr. Springer: The Site Plan Review Committee (SPRC) has completed its review of the above referenced project. The SPRC finds that your project is consistent with City policy and development standards provided the following conditions of approval are satisfied. Pursuant to Chapter 15.49, Integrated Project Review Process, a project which is subject to Site Pian Approval is a Type II Permit and can be appealed to the City Council. An appeal must be filed within 14 days of the date of this notice. Site Plan Approval is valid for 18 months from the date of this letter. The affected property owners may request a change in property tax valuation from the Thurston County Tax Assessors Office. The project is approved subject to the following conditions of approval: Civil Plan Submission: The plans submitted for review are inconsistent. For example, the plans included in the storm drain report are different than the full size site plan. Please submit revised civil plans including changes required in this letter. After SPRC review and approval of revised civil plans, you may submit building permit application. All final civil plans, reports, and specifications must be consistent with 1992 Department of Ecology Stormwater Manual. The plans and reports must be stamped and signed by a Washington State licensed professional engineer. The stamped date must not be expired. The Lasco Bathware Plant is located adjacent to Rhoton Rd. S.E. This site is contributing to the consistent flooding of Rhoton Rd., between Central Reddi Mix and Lasco Bathware. The City of Yelm is requesting a meeting with the applicant to discuss the possible solutions to this recurring problem. Civil Engineering Plan Review No. 1, by Jim Gibson, Development Services Engineer: Please review these comments and address them when you submit your final civil engineering plans for review. These comments are from your land use application. You are still required to submit plans for civil engineering review prior to be able to construct this project. If you have any questions regarding these comments, please call Jim Gibson, Development Services Engineer, at (360) 458-8438. 1. All plans, reports and calculations need to have a current stamp and signature from a civil engineer registered in the State of Washington. 2. All information needed by the contractor to construct these improvements needs to be shown on the civil engineering plans. (i.e. trench sections, vault sections, plan views of all pipe connections, test pit locations, electrical connection etc.) Please add the additional information to the plans. 3. Please review section 3-3.6.5 of the 1992 DOE Stormwater manual. This will outline the requirements for soils investigation. Additional information will be required based on the manual. The soils investigation needs to be stamped by the civil engineer or the soils specialist who performed the testing. 4. The infiltration gallery bottom is required to be 36" above the highwater table. The report says that the highwater table is 72" below grade. Please revise the design to meet this requirement. 5. The infiltration gallery is required to infiltrate the 100-year design storm. The calculations appear to use the 10-year design storm. Please clarify or revise the plans as required. 6. Please show where the roof drains are located, how they are being connected and where they are being connected to the conveyance system. 7. The oil water separator specified on the plan is actually a grease interceptor. Please specify another model and type of oil water separator for this project. 8. If the oil water separator is not rated for truck loading than place bollards around the vault and add a detail to the plans. 9. All pump wiring shall be Class 1, Div 1, intrinsically safe electrical components and assembly. Please add this note to the plans.
